QuickOPC User's Guide and Reference
AcknowledgeRequired Property (AEEventData)



OpcLabs.EasyOpcClassicCore Assembly > OpcLabs.EasyOpc.AlarmsAndEvents Namespace > AEEventData Class : AcknowledgeRequired Property
This flag indicates that the related condition requires acknowledgment of this event.
Syntax
'Declaration
 
<DefaultValueAttribute(False)>
Public Property AcknowledgeRequired As Boolean
'Usage
 
Dim instance As AEEventData
Dim value As Boolean
 
instance.AcknowledgeRequired = value
 
value = instance.AcknowledgeRequired
[DefaultValue(false)]
public bool AcknowledgeRequired {get; set;}
[DefaultValue(false)]
public:
property bool AcknowledgeRequired {
   bool get();
   void set (    bool value);
}
Remarks

This property is used only for Condition-Related Events (see EventType).

The determination of those events which require acknowledgment is server specific. For example, transition into a LimitAlarm condition would likely require an acknowledgment, while the event notification of the resulting acknowledgment would likely not require an acknowledgment.

This method or property does not throw any exceptions, aside from execution exceptions such as System.Threading.ThreadAbortException or System.OutOfMemoryException.

Requirements

Target Platforms: .NET Framework: Windows 10 (selected versions), Windows 11 (selected versions), Windows Server 2016, Windows Server 2022; .NET: Linux, macOS, Microsoft Windows

See Also